Kimetso no Yaiba is objectively one of the most popular anime of all time. Based on the manga by Koyoharu Gotouge, the shonen ...
The techniques or forms of Water Breathing all involve moving a Slayer's body, arms, and weapon in fluid motions to mimic the ...
The release date for the first Demon Slayer Infinity Castle movie has been revealed. As revealed at the Corps Gathering event on March 1, the upcoming feature is hitting cinemas on July 18, 2025. For ...